Both KMS and CloudHSM are FIPS 140-2 Level 3 and AWS claims they cannot read private keys from KMS. The main difference is KMS uses IAM and the AWS REST API while CloudHMS uses PKCS #11/JCE and a separate permissions system.

They have a minor capability to do intra-constellation routing now but if they want to operate in China the authorities are going to demand all data be downlinked through Chinese downlink stations so they can do their monitoring.
I wasn't aware that China does this. I know India does too though, for this reason only Inmarsat is allowed there because they cooperate with the authorities (and I believe even that is subject to local licensing). Though India doesn't have a great firewall so it's much less of an issue for foreigners visiting there.
